Vandal damages bathroom at Veterans Memorial Park: Parma Police Blotter

PARMA, Ohio

Vandalism: State Road

On June 5, police were dispatched to Veterans Memorial Park regarding a vandalism call.

An arriving officer said someone damaged a restroom near the concession and baseball field building.

There are no suspects. Police are investigating.

Drug abuse: Broadview Road

During a June 6 traffic stop of a Ford F150 for a moving violation on Broadview Road, police discovered suspected felony drugs.

The Cleveland driver was arrested for drug abuse.

Stolen vehicle parts: Pearl Road

On June 6, police were dispatched to Tom’s Auto Repair after an employee discovered that a catalytic converter was missing from a Honda Element, which had been left at the Pearl Road garage for service.

There are no suspects. Police are investigating.

Drug abuse: State Road

During a June 7 traffic stop of a Toyota for an equipment violation on State Road, police found suspected felony drugs.

The Parma driver was arrested for drug abuse.

Fraud: South Canterbury Road

On May 31, a South Canterbury Road resident called police after discovering fraudulent charges had been made to their bank account by an unknown person.

There are no suspects. Police are investigating.
